Holger Lippmann, a trailblazer in the realm of net art, has continuously pushed the boundaries of creativity through his exploration of the computer as a medium. With a background in fine arts and a deep understanding of computational processes, Lippmann's work stands at the intersection of art and technology, capturing the essence of our culture in its most essential form.
Having studied at the prestigious Hochschule für Bildende Künste in Dresden and trained at the CIMdata Institute in Berlin, Lippmann's artistic journey has taken him across the globe, from the Institut des Hautes Etudes en Arts Plastiques in Paris to the Institute of Technology in New York. His contributions to the field have been recognized with notable accolades such as the "Teletext Art Prize" and the International media award "POPULAR."

The theme of landscapes has become a constant companion in Lippmann's work, stemming from a transformative experience during a trip through the Alps. The vastness, rhythmic beauty, and depth of the natural landscape left an indelible mark on his artistic sensibilities. However, Lippmann's intention is not to create landscape illustrations per se. Instead, he harnesses the joy of playing with code to generate abstract structures that evoke a sense of familiarity while leaving room for the imagination to roam freely.
Lippmann's artistic process involves the creation of softly morphing blob shapes that traverse the canvas, leaving their trails behind. Through the layering of virtual three-dimensional forms and the strategic use of color palettes, Lippmann constructs staggered fields that captivate the viewer. The interplay between random color sequences and grayscale tones adds an element of surprise, reminiscent of the thawing of snow in spring or the sudden appearance of forgotten treasures. Each composition holds a delicate balance between vibrant colors and concealed secrets, inviting the viewer to explore and uncover hidden layers of meaning.
